    Multiplayer online battle arena (MOBA) [a] is a subgenre of strategy video games in which two teams of players compete against each other on a predefined battlefield. Each player controls a single character with a set of distinctive abilities that improve over the course of a game and which contribute to the team's overall strategy. [1]

    The Fehu rune ᚠ (Old Norse fé; Old English feoh) represents the f sound in the Younger Futhark and Futhorc alphabets. Its name means ' (mobile) wealth', cognate to English fee with the original meaning of ' sheep ' or ' cattle ' (Dutch Vee, German Vieh, Latin pecū, Sanskrit páśu).
